Rule 5005 - Civil Rules Committee

A civil procedural rules committee shall be appointed within sixty (60) days of the effective date of these rules to study and make recommendations to the court concerning local procedure in civil matters and the promulgation and amendment of local rules of civil procedure. The committee shall be composed of a judge of this court and members in good standing of the Bar of the Supreme Court of Pennsylvania who maintain principal offices for the practice of law in Chester County, all of whom shall be appointed by the president judge. The chairman of the committee shall be a non-judicial member of the committee and shall be designated by the president judge. The committee shall meet as directed by the president judge, or by the chairman of the committee, but in no event less often than semi-annually.
